The growing demand for high-end aluminum strips is driving a wave of intelligent upgrades in finishing production lines.

In recent years, with the rapid development of emerging industries such as new-energy vehicles, photovoltaics, and aerospace, the market demand for high-end aluminum strips has shown a significant growth trend. The increasing need for lightweighting in new-energy vehicles has driven extensive applications of aluminum in areas like vehicle body structural components and battery trays, significantly boosting the amount of aluminum used per vehicle compared to traditional fuel-powered cars. Meanwhile, the widespread adoption of bifacial power generation technology in the photovoltaic industry has led to a surge in demand for high-precision aluminum frames. In addition, the aerospace sector continues to see rising demand for high-strength aluminum alloys and aluminum-based composite materials. These developments have prompted the aluminum processing industry to shift toward higher-end and precision-oriented production, placing greater demands on finishing equipment systems.
Against this backdrop, the intelligent upgrading of finishing production lines has become an industry-wide development trend. Taking Shougang Cold Rolling as an example, the company has developed an intelligent scheduling decision system for its finishing processes, leveraging advanced AI models to achieve a unit allocation accuracy rate exceeding 99.2% and ensuring 100% compliance with scheduling rules, thereby significantly boosting production efficiency. Meanwhile, the Leisteel Plate and Strip Plant's centralized control center for heat treatment integrates 36 automated devices to establish a full-process material tracking system, enabling centralized and intelligent management of the entire heat treatment production line. Additionally, Yijing Machinery has introduced an intelligent aluminum extrusion line that utilizes IoT technology to connect equipment and create digital twins, allowing real-time production data to be uploaded to the cloud—thus helping enterprises optimize their production planning. These initiatives demonstrate that intelligent upgrades have emerged as a critical pathway for enhancing both production efficiency and product quality in the high-end aluminum strip sector.
